Story
You can fill out an adoption application online on our official website. Since moving into his new foster home Bart has been coming out of his shell and showing us more and more of his personality. He loving playing with toys, especially ropes and the stuffed reindeer (even though it lost an antler lol). He is VERY well house trained and has never had an accident in the house. He really enjoys walks, still marks posts and signs like a typical boy, and seems to go easier on leash pulling the longer he is walked. He is not a fan of indoor stairs but stomps up the outside stairs without hesitation. He is a vocal boy when he wants something and can be mouthy during play but not in an aggressive nature. His foster mom is working with him on manners and says he responds best to reward. If he shows undesirable behaviors, ignoring him seems to produce the best results followed by playtime and treats when he follows commands. His most favorite thing in the world is lounging on the couch, which is where you would find him most times. Due to his history of being stray he will need to be leashed at all times when outside if adopter does not have a secured fenced in yard. Underground fence systems will not be allowed for Bart. He does not care for the crate but also doesnt need crated as he is a very well behaved dog. Bart could live successfully in a home as an only dog or with other dogs that are calm, extremely active dogs seem to make him a bit nervous, as do chaotic home environments. This extremely handsome would love nothing more than a couch to lay on and some blankets to burry into, some walks during the day, continued obedience, and most importantly, LOVE.
